Page 1: Bejewelled watch

No, we don’t mean being stuck in some distortion of a time-space ‘ dis’-continuum. What we do mean is flaunting a timepiece that is not your typical symmetrical watch… Think warped dials and elaborately designed straps that break the conventional norms

of watchmaking and define the quintessential nonconformist. It’s time to strap on some rebellion!

BY DESSIDRE FLEMING

TIME WARPED

Cartier The Crash Skeleton watch is one of the Maison’s first shaped movements, the calibre 9618 MC. The timepiece transcends the general perception of shape and design in watchmaking.

Chopard The Xtravaganza timepiece reinterprets that idea of eternal roundedness with Roman numerals, frosted with diamonds, making up the dial. The watch pays homage to the dance of numbers, as the four hour-markers make for a stunning frame.

Breguet From the Reine de Naples Haute Joaillerie collection, this timepiece boasts of an iconic shape and bracelet set with diamonds and sapphires. The dial is a beautiful mix of bluish natural mother-of-pearl, white gold and diamonds, which is highlighted by baguette diamonds on the bezel and case band.

Bulgari Reintroducing an eternal masterpiece is Bulgari’s all-new Serpenti watch, which has been reinterpreted in a fantastical, or what one could call a geometrically abstract, manner. The pink gold case and black-lacquered dial come with 6 brilliant-cut diamonds and 12 set-diamond hour-markers.

Jaquet DrozThe Lady 8 Flower is an expression of refined femininity, enhanced by astounding design. With its distinctive silhouette, the watch raises the bar for elegance in watchmaking. The timepiece is made up of two circles, superimposed to form an ‘8’—an emblematic number for Jaquet Droz. The lower circle which forms the dial features a delicate butterfly with outspread wings.

Dior The Dior Grand Soir 28 mm reproducible timepiece is inspired by the whalebones of a petticoat. The shaded hues of the baguette diamonds evoke the pleats, while the asymmetrical shape and the corolla wavy movement of the bezel symbolise the swirl of a ballgown. The mother-of-pearl marquetry is engraved and hand-painted.

de GrisogonoThe Crazy Skull by de Grisogono is a superlative masterpiece in watchmaking that thumbs its nose, literally so, at conventions. The watch is a provocative symbol of freedom and non-conformity. The skull-shaped dial is set with more than 890 black diamonds and is embellished with a heart-cut white diamond for a nose.

GraffThe Diamond Swan Watch is one of the most delightful jewellery watches by Graff. The fully diamond-paved timepiece is a motif of the swan—the guardian of time—floating gracefully across a sculptural diamond bracelet as one wing slides to reveal a secret delicate dial. The entire watch is laden with no fewer than 900 diamonds.

Gucci The Diamond Horsebit bracelet watch comes in a stainless steel case with a mother-of-pearl dial enclosed by a diamond-encrusted bezel. The dial is in the shape of a horseshoe, which is known to be a symbol of good fortune. 

PiagetFrom the Mediterranean Garden collection, this timepiece by Piaget is set in an 18-carat pink gold case and encrusted with 668 brilliant-cut diamonds. The dial is in the shape of a rose in full bloom, in diamond frosting. The bracelet features 12 pear-shaped green tourmalines and 488 brilliant-cut diamonds.

Chanel From the latest collection titled Les Éternelles de Chanel, the high jewellery Plume Secret Watch features a majestic feather—the inspiration for Mademoisselle Gabrielle Chanel—set across the diamond cuff swarming in a trail of pink sapphire droplets. The feather moves to reveal a dial paved with pink baguette sapphires.

Van Cleef & Arpels The Cadenas watch is an amalgamation of beauty and functionality. Taken from the French word meaning ‘lock’, the timepiece features a dial in the shape of an elaborate lock, which symbolises union and alliance.

Jaeger-LeCoultreFrom the collection of Extraordinary Haute Joaillerie watches, this timepiece conjures up a fairy tale with its enchanting design. Set in a white gold case, the bracelet is festooned with white diamonds and the dial is in the shape of leaf, which glides over to reveal the hands of the clock.
